SRW Agency Announces Record Quarter of New Business, Partnerships with Rebbl, Good Culture and More

CHICAGO, March 15, 2021 /PRNewswire/ — SRW, an independent, full-service marketing agency leader among natural, wellness and better-for-you-brands, today announced a slew of major client wins in Q1 2021. The ragtag bunch of hooligans now adds four more food and beverage brands to its impressive client portfolio, which already includes Simple Mills, Harvest Snaps, Kite Hill and more.

  • Rebbl, B-corp creator of award-winning, plant-based elixirs
  • Good Culture, cultured dairy innovators and leaders in the regenerative agriculture movement
  • Bridor, North American manufacturer for high quality breads and pastries, of the global Le Duff Group
  • Fifth Season, VC-backed, Pittsburgh-based grower of fresh, organic produce through vertical farming

In less than a month, SRW has won three requests for proposal – an indicator of the agency’s reputation and successful track record. Securing these clients solidifies SRW’s reputation as the leading agency in the wellness space, and continues the agency’s growth trajectory reached in 2020 with the addition of clients like Stephanie Izard’s This Little Goat. While the traditional agency model was challenged continually by the pandemic, SRW continued to grow – helping its partners do the same.
